Output 21c620c25dbc615321104b5f11df16a55e72d09caf72e0c4d39fd99db357609e:1

value
2086720
script pubkey
OP_0 OP_PUSHBYTES_20 6569f06f3646b66ecdda2f057d32689ba80eb14c
address
ltc1qv45lqmekg6mxanw69uzh6vngnw5qav2vuxddt9
transaction
21c620c25dbc615321104b5f11df16a55e72d09caf72e0c4d39fd99db357609e
spent
true